qml.data.Dataset

class Dataset(bind=None, *, data_name=None, identifiers=None, **attrs)[source]

Bases: pennylane.data.base.mapper.MapperMixin, pennylane.data.base.dataset._DatasetTransform

Base class for Datasets.

attr_info

Returns a mapping of the AttributeInfo for each of this dataset’s attributes.

attrs

Returns all attributes of this Dataset.

bind: HDF5Group

Return the HDF5 group that contains this dataset.

data_name

Returns the data name (category) of this dataset.

fields: ClassVar[Mapping[str, pennylane.data.base.dataset.Field]] = mappingproxy({})

A mapping of attribute names to their Attribute information. Note that this contains attributes declared on the class, not attributes added to an instance. Use attrs to view all attributes on an instance.

identifiers

Returns this dataset’s parameters.

info

Return metadata associated with this dataset.

type_id = 'dataset'

Type identifier for this dataset. Used internally to load datasets from other datasets.

close()[source]

Close the underlying dataset file. The dataset will become inaccessible.

list_attributes()[source]

Returns a list of this dataset’s attributes.

classmethod open(filepath, mode='r')[source]

Open existing dataset or create a new one at filepath.

Parameters
  • filepath – Path to dataset file

  • mode – File handling mode. Possible values are “w-” (create, fail if file exists), “w” (create, overwrite existing), “a” (append existing, create if doesn’t exist), “r” (read existing, must exist), and “copy”, which loads the dataset into memory and detaches it from the underlying file. Default is “r”.

Returns

Dataset object from file

read(source, attributes=None, *, overwrite=False)[source]

Load dataset from HDF5 file at filepath.

Parameters
  • source – Dataset, or path to HDF5 file containing dataset, from which to read attributes

  • attributes – Optional list of attributes to copy. If None, all attributes will be copied.

  • overwrite – Whether to overwrite attributes that already exist in this dataset.

write(dest, mode='a', attributes=None, *, overwrite=False)[source]

Write dataset to HDF5 file at filepath.

Parameters
  • dest – HDF5 file, or path to HDF5 file containing dataset, to write attributes to

  • mode – File handling mode, if source is a file system path. Possible values are “w-” (create, fail if file exists), “w” (create, overwrite existing), and “a” (append existing, create if doesn’t exist). Default is “w-“.

  • attributes – Optional list of attributes to copy. If None, all attributes will be copied. Note that identifiers will always be copied.

  • overwrite – Whether to overwrite attributes that already exist in this dataset.
